Where is Scuol located?

Scuol is a municipality in the canton of Graubünden in Switzerland and lies at an altitude of around 1,250 meters. Nestled in the impressive landscape of the Alps, Scuol offers a wide range of leisure activities all year round. Surrounded by the imposing peaks of the Engadin, the village is a popular destination for nature lovers. The Scuol webcam offers you an excellent view of the surrounding mountain panorama.

What's going on in Scuol?

Two snowboarders with a view of the snow-covered mountains near Scuol in Switzerland

By merging the three vacation regions of Engadin Scuol, Engadin Samnaun and Engadin Val Müstair into a single destination, guests can enjoy the full range of winter activities. Duty-free shopping in Samnaun, enjoying the wonderful spa landscape of the Bogn Engiadina in Scuol or experiencing culture in the UNESCO World Heritage Engadin Val Müstair - each of the three regions has a unique offer. A total of 58 lifts with a capacity of 105,000 people per hour are available in the Engadin Scuol Samnaun destination. Over 340 kilometers of pistes with varied descents are waiting to be discovered, so that all skiers are guaranteed to find their ideal route. What can you do in Scuol?

Mountain bikers on a panoramic trail with a mountain backdrop near Scuol in Graubünden

In the Lower Engadine with its main town of Scuol, the idyllic picture-book villages with their artistically decorated facades and sgraffito decorations are strung together like a string of pearls. The snow paradise of Motta Naluns attracts visitors with 80 kilometers of pistes and offers ideal conditions for winter sports fans. If you want to explore this snow sports area (1,250 - 2,785 m), you can either take the gondola lift directly from Scuol or the chairlift from Ftan to the heights of the ski area. One of the most beautiful descents is the red slope, which is around ten kilometers long and winds its way from the 2,710-meter-high Salaniva mountain to Sent (1,430 meters). Those with small children will find excellent conditions in the Lower Engadine: the covered Wonder Carpet in Kinderland is 115 meters long, making it ideal for those first turns, while two other Wonder Carpets (60 and 70 meters) are also available. In addition, all chairlifts are equipped with a child safety device. After a day on the slopes, the pool area of the Bogn Engiadina invites you to relax - a perfect way to end the day. The weather in Scuol

The weather in Scuol is typically alpine with frosty winters, which ensure the best winter sports conditions, and pleasantly fresh summers, which are ideal for hiking and mountain biking. The amount of precipitation varies throughout the year, with more rain in summer and less in spring.
